to come full circle
01

to go through a series of efforts or actions only to end up back where one started, highlighting the lack of progress or meaningful change

to [come|go|turn] full circle definition and meaning
Idiom
Ejemplos
The city had turned full circle, as it had undergone a revitalization that had brought it back to its former glory as a cultural center.
